只是用于自己记录,方便以后查阅,就直接上代码了
/**Activity 套Fragment*/
inline fun <reified T : Fragment> AppCompatActivity.addFragment(@IdRes containerViewId: Int) {
supportFragmentManager.beginTransaction().add(containerViewId,
newInstanceFragment<T>()).commit()
}
/**Activity 套Fragment*/
inline fun <reified T : Fragment> AppCompatActivity.replaceFragment(@IdRes containerViewId: Int) {
supportFragmentManager.beginTransaction().replace(containerViewId,
newInstanceFragment<T>()).commit()
}